Re: Pictures from its longest journey ever! 100314
202
ACL 30thou race pistons
ACL race bearings
Reground crank
Standard rods
30-70 Hyd Cam
New lifters
JP High Vol oil pump
Alloy timing gear
186 head - big valves, removed inlet posts, larger exhaust ports, crane roller rockers
Electric Dizzy
Rebuilt fuel pump
Not too wild, but should go alright with 9psi through it.
It is brand new, and has never been started. I saw it in the local second hand newspaper and had to give it a go!
